A second person charged with a 200-thousand-dollar jewelry store robbery in St. Joseph has pleaded guity. Vincent Irwin of Kansas City Kansas is one of four people charged in the case. The other two are facing trial on March 20th. Irwin admits he and the others took the jewelry to a pawn shop in Kansas City and fenced it.
